Transaction 839e57ff33fbd990dfa33716de4182a22c0843401576ea96b4d4881974bce27c

1 Input
2 Outputs
  • 839e57ff33fbd990dfa33716de4182a22c0843401576ea96b4d4881974bce27c:0
  • value  12797354
    address  32snsRh3BvaSCJByKtdyMqcX9fnUvccG6n
  • 839e57ff33fbd990dfa33716de4182a22c0843401576ea96b4d4881974bce27c:1
  • value  858000
    address  3AfeiBioyZziiUPvZGwwTkhEyCmxy76XKt